Certain Folders are not Visible in Windows Explorer

Hellow Friends,

Last day i had a Problem with Windows Explorer due to this problem Some Folders are not visible in Windows Explorer.

My File server was 2008 R2 SP1 and accessing shared files from Windows 7 , XP and all other flavours of OS, but i was not able to access that folders.
After trouble shooting of this problem i found interesting thing, when i access folders with Full path in explorer than it was accessible, but the same folder was not accessible via Command Prompt.

I have changed Folder Option to show hidden files and Folder but the problem was still remains then after i decided to start server in safe mode and full scan with fully updated Antivirus software but problem was not resolved.

Finally i got the problem resolution with cause.

Cause :

This problem may arise due to Some system file corruption or Malicious software / Virus issues which change some system settings.

Resolution :

1) Open Command Prompt.
2) Go to your Folder Drive
3) Type Command " attrib -h -r -s /D /S < Folder Name >" or " attrib -h -r -s /D /S < *.*>"
4) hit Enter
5) Bang!!!!! now Files and Folders will appears with existing File and Folder permissions.
